Old-Fashioned Lemonade
Fill a teapot full of water and bring to a boil. In a small saucepan, bring 1/4 cup water to a boil. Add 1/4 cup sugar; stir till dissolved. Add the zest of one lemon and one lime and the juice of 3 lemons and 3 limes to the sugar water. Stir and pour into 6 cup container. Add 5 cups boiling water; stir and chill. Serve with lots of ice and garnish with mint leaves or lemon balm.
